Common HVAC Emergencies That Require Immediate Attention

Numerous HVAC issues require emergency service. Acknowledging these concerns can assist you know when to require expert assistance:

  • Complete System Failure
    When your heating or cooling system stops working completely, particularly during severe weather condition, it's more than simply an inconvenience-- it can be dangerous. Our emergency HVAC professionals can identify and fix the issue without delay, restoring your home's convenience and security.
  • Uncommon Noises or Smells
    Unusual seem like banging, grinding, or shrieking from your HVAC system often signify a severe mechanical issue that might lead to bigger problems if not attended to quickly. Likewise, uncommon smells may suggest electrical problems or perhaps gas leaks. Our professional HVAC specialists can recognize these issues and make necessary repair work before they end up being dangerous.
  • Water Leaks
    Water dripping from your HVAC system can damage your home and cause mold development. Our professionals find the source of leakages and fix them properly to prevent water damage.
  • Refrigerant Leaks
    Refrigerant leakages decrease your a/c's cooling capacity and can harm the environment. They require professional attention as refrigerant handling calls for specialized training and equipment.
  • Electrical Issues
    Issues with electrical parts in your HVAC system position fire threats and need to be dealt with instantly by certified professionals. Our HVAC specialists have the training to securely repair electrical issues.

Heating Unit Maintenance

Regular maintenance prevents lots of heating issues and extends the life of your system. Our expert HVAC contractors carry out thorough maintenance services that consist of:

  • Inspecting heat exchangers for cracks
  • Inspecting combustion performance
  • Testing safety controls
  • Cleaning up or changing filters
  • Checking electrical connections
  • Oiling moving parts
  • Cleaning up burners and adjusting the flame

Common H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Limited air flow makes your system work harder and lowers convenience. Our HVAC contractors recognize airflow issues, whether caused by duct problems, dirty filters, or fan issues.
  • Irregular Heating or Cooling
    If some spaces are too hot while others are too cold, you may have duct problems, insulation problems, or an incorrectly sized system. Our professional HVAC professionals can detect these problems and advise solutions.
  • Short Cycling
    When your system switches on and off regularly, it squanders energy and breaks elements much faster. Our HVAC contractors can determine whether the problem comes from a stopped up filter, inappropriate thermostat settings, or something more serious.
  • High Energy Bills
    Abrupt increases in energy expenses often indicate HVAC inadequacy. Our professionals carry out energy efficiency evaluations to determine the cause and recommend improvements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ems must assist manage indoor humidity. If your home feels too damp in summertime or too dry in winter, our HVAC specialists can advise options to enhance convenience and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    Sometimes what looks like a system failure is really a thermostat issue. Our HVAC contractors can repair or replace thermostats and assist you upgrade to programmable or wise designs for better comfort control and energy cost savings.
